@import "https://fonts.googleapis.com/css2?family=Inter:wght@400;500;600;700;800&family=JetBrains+Mono:wght@500;700&display=swap";
:root{--background:#0b0b0c;--foreground:#ededed;--card:#11111399;--card-border:#ffffff14;--primary:#fff;--secondary:#888;--accent:#3b82f6;--muted:#27272a;--radius:14px;--max-width:1100px;--font-sans:"Inter",-apple-system,system-ui,sans-serif;--font-mono:"JetBrains Mono",monospace;--shadow-premium:0 20px 40px -15px #00000080;--glass-border:1px solid #ffffff1a;--glass-bg:#111113cc}*{box-sizing:border-box;-webkit-font-smoothing:antialiased;margin:0;padding:0}body{font-family:var(--font-sans);background:var(--background);color:var(--foreground);line-height:1.6;overflow-x:hidden}h1,h2,h3,h4{letter-spacing:-.05em;color:var(--primary);font-weight:700;line-height:1.1}main{max-width:var(--max-width);margin:0 auto;padding:60px 24px}header{border-bottom:var(--glass-border);background:var(--glass-bg);-webkit-backdrop-filter:blur(20px)saturate(180%);backdrop-filter:blur(20px)saturate(180%);z-index:100;padding:18px 0;position:sticky;top:0}.header-inner{max-width:var(--max-width);justify-content:space-between;align-items:center;margin:0 auto;padding:0 24px;display:flex}.logo{color:var(--primary);letter-spacing:-.06em;font-size:20px;font-weight:800;text-decoration:none}.nav-link{color:var(--secondary);font-size:14px;font-weight:500;text-decoration:none;transition:color .3s cubic-bezier(.16,1,.3,1)}.nav-link:hover{color:var(--primary)}.hero{text-align:center;padding:80px 0 60px;animation:.8s cubic-bezier(.16,1,.3,1) fadeIn}.hero h1{background:linear-gradient(#fff 0%,#ffffffb3 100%);-webkit-text-fill-color:transparent;-webkit-background-clip:text;margin-bottom:20px;font-size:clamp(40px,8vw,72px)}.hero p{color:var(--secondary);max-width:600px;margin:0 auto 48px;font-size:clamp(16px,2vw,20px);font-weight:400}.search-container{max-width:540px;margin:0 auto;position:relative}.search-input{border:var(--glass-border);color:#fff;-webkit-backdrop-filter:blur(4px);backdrop-filter:blur(4px);background:#ffffff08;border-radius:99px;outline:none;width:100%;padding:18px 28px;font-size:16px;transition:all .4s cubic-bezier(.16,1,.3,1);box-shadow:0 8px 32px #0003}.search-input:focus{background:#ffffff12;border-color:#ffffff4d;transform:translateY(-2px);box-shadow:0 0 0 4px #ffffff0d,0 8px 32px #0000004d}.tool-grid{grid-template-columns:1fr;gap:40px;margin-top:60px;display:grid}.tool-card{background:var(--card);border:var(--glass-border);border-radius:var(--radius);box-shadow:var(--shadow-premium);padding:32px;position:relative;overflow:hidden}.tool-card:before{content:"";background:linear-gradient(90deg,#0000,#ffffff1a,#0000);height:1px;position:absolute;top:0;left:0;right:0}.pro-calc{max-width:500px;margin:0 auto}.sci-display{text-align:right;background:#000;border:1px solid #ffffff0d;border-radius:12px;flex-direction:column;justify-content:flex-end;min-height:140px;margin-bottom:24px;padding:24px;display:flex;box-shadow:inset 0 2px 20px #00000080}.sci-expr{color:var(--secondary);font-size:14px;font-family:var(--font-mono);opacity:.6;margin-bottom:8px}.sci-val{color:#fff;font-size:40px;font-weight:700;font-family:var(--font-mono);letter-spacing:-2px;scrollbar-width:none;overflow-x:auto}.sci-grid{grid-template-columns:repeat(7,1fr);gap:10px;display:grid}.sci-btn{color:#bbb;cursor:pointer;-webkit-user-select:none;user-select:none;background:#ffffff08;border:1px solid #ffffff0d;border-radius:10px;padding:14px 0;font-size:13px;font-weight:600;transition:all .2s cubic-bezier(.16,1,.3,1)}.sci-btn:hover{color:#fff;background:#ffffff14;border-color:#ffffff1a}.sci-btn:active{transform:scale(.95)}.sci-btn.op{color:var(--accent);background:#3b82f60d}.sci-btn.num{color:#fff;background:#ffffff0d;font-size:18px}.sci-btn.eq{background:var(--accent);color:#fff;border:none;font-size:18px}.sci-btn.util{color:#f87171;background:#ef44441a}.perc-form{flex-direction:column;gap:20px;display:flex}.perc-row{background:#ffffff05;border:1px solid #ffffff08;border-radius:12px;flex-wrap:wrap;align-items:center;gap:12px;padding:20px;display:flex}.perc-row input{color:#fff;background:#000;border:1px solid #ffffff1a;border-radius:8px;outline:none;width:100px;padding:10px 14px;font-size:15px;transition:border .3s}.perc-row input:focus{border-color:var(--accent)}.perc-res{color:var(--accent);margin-left:auto;font-size:18px;font-weight:700}.category-section{margin-top:80px}.section-label{text-transform:uppercase;letter-spacing:.2em;color:var(--secondary);margin-bottom:32px;font-size:12px;font-weight:700}.sitemap-grid{grid-template-columns:repeat(auto-fill,minmax(300px,1fr));gap:24px;display:grid}.category-card{background:var(--card);border:var(--glass-border);border-radius:var(--radius);padding:28px;text-decoration:none;transition:all .4s cubic-bezier(.16,1,.3,1)}.category-card:hover{background:#ffffff0d;border-color:#fff3;transform:translateY(-4px)}.category-card h3{margin-bottom:12px;font-size:18px}.unit-list{list-style:none}.unit-list li{margin-bottom:10px}.unit-list a{color:var(--secondary);font-size:14px;text-decoration:none;transition:color .2s}.unit-list a:hover{color:var(--primary)}@keyframes fadeIn{0%{opacity:0;transform:translateY(20px)}to{opacity:1;transform:translateY(0)}}@media (max-width:768px){main{padding:40px 16px}.hero{padding:40px 0}.sci-grid{grid-template-columns:repeat(4,1fr)}.sci-btn.hide-mobile{display:none}.perc-row{flex-direction:column;align-items:flex-start}.perc-row input{width:100%}.perc-res{margin-top:8px;margin-left:0}}footer{border-top:var(--glass-border);color:var(--secondary);text-align:center;padding:60px 24px;font-size:14px}.footer-inner p{opacity:.6}
